From the bestselling co-author of Apollo 13 comes a gripping, long-overdue chronicle of the groundbreaking Gemini program—the daring bridge between America’s first steps into space and the triumph of the moon landing.
Without Gemini, there would be no Apollo.
Before Neil Armstrong set foot on the moon, a small group of astronauts and engineers took humanity’s boldest leaps aboard Gemini spacecraft. Between Mercury’s first tentative orbits and Apollo’s historic lunar missions, Gemini’s ten missions over twenty months laid the essential groundwork for every success that followed.
In Gemini, acclaimed author Jeffrey Kluger—renowned for his riveting storytelling and deep space expertise—reveals the untold story of NASA’s most pivotal and least appreciated program. The Gemini missions tested the limits of endurance, technology, and courage. Astronauts faced near-death experiences, political pressure, and fierce competition with the Soviet Union as they mastered spacewalks, rendezvous, and docking—skills that made lunar travel possible.
Set against the backdrop of the Vietnam War and a skeptical Congress questioning NASA’s value, Gemini captures the drama, danger, and determination of the men and women who kept America’s dream of space exploration alive. Through meticulous research and firsthand interviews, Kluger brings to life the raw ambition and quiet heroism that defined an era.
